Ethereum
Block
21118748
0x3d89803e400851d4e2d1c5b8bc0c2649781a6a43
EOA
Active on
Ethereum with -- and
3 txns
Funded by
0x7ab2
…
f180
via
0xd59a
…
15b6
First active
2 months ago
Last active
2 months ago
Loading...